Description
Technical field:
This utility model relates to scrap metal recycling field, is specifically related to a kind of metal expense material size automatic measuring recording equipment.
Background technology:
Metal structure manufacturing enterprise can produce a lot of scrap metal in process of manufacture, if these a little waste materials directly abandon can cause serious environmental pollution, best bet be just able to waste material is carried out again with, and often these waste materials, leftover pieces all there is also some use value, such as some less parts of processing and fabricating, and majority metal structure manufacturing enterprise is very low to the utilization rate of blank material, cause a lot of waste material, the waste of leftover pieces, virtually add production cost, the main cause that waste material is difficult to recycle wherein is caused to have any to be after whether staff cannot know and have in this batch of waste material and oneself can utilize waste material, if the result blindly found in large quantities of waste materials is the waste material not being suitable for oneself using, so not only do not save production cost, waste the substantial amounts of working time on the contrary, reduce work task efficiency, therefore the enthusiasm that waste material is recycled by workman is just reduced, the waste of waste material will certainly be caused if things go on like this, improve production cost, also exacerbate environmental pollution simultaneously, so, if the overall dimensions of waste material can being unified record and being easy to workman finds rapidly whether have required waste material, the enthusiasm that then waste material is recycled by the adjustable people that starts building.
Utility model content:
This utility model provides a kind of metal expense material size automatic measuring recording equipment, it utilizes advanced laser measuring technique and linear drive technique that the overall dimensions of the leftover bits such as steel plate, iron plate is carried out automatic Scanning Detction, and data are uploaded to host computer carry out unifying record, thus being automatically performed the measurement to waste material, numbering and record, facilitate the lookup retrieval that waste material is recycled by workman.
Metal of the present utility model takes material size automatic measuring recording equipment, the technical scheme adopted for achieving the above object is in that: include workbench and switch board, near being symmetrically arranged on two with support column on described workbench, it is provided with slideway near upper end level between two support columns, slideway is provided with slide block, the top of one of them support column is provided with the first electric cylinder, the leading screw connection sliding block of the first electric cylinder, described slide block is provided with the second electric cylinder, the end of the leading screw of the second electric cylinder is provided with locating piece, the bottom of locating piece is provided with laser range finder, laser range finder connects the controller in switch board, controller connects host computer by network.
As further improvement of the utility model, the top of described locating piece is provided with the position sensor being connected with controller, controller connects the first electric cylinder and the second electric cylinder respectively, the shift position of laser range finder is detected in real time by position sensor, controller controls the operation of two electric cylinders according to the physical location of laser range finder, and then the shift position of laser range finder is carried out auto-control.
As further improvement of the utility model, four corner points bottom described workbench are provided with universal wheel, whole device can be made arbitrarily to move by the setting of universal wheel, in order to arbitrarily to walk in workshop, the waste material workpiece leaving different location in is detected.
As further improvement of the utility model, described laser range finder and position sensor sequentially pass through signal conditioner respectively and A/D converter connects controller, it is adjusted amplifying to improve the accuracy of signal transmission to detection signal by signal conditioner, after carrying out not genus conversion again through A/D converter, sends controller to.
The beneficial effects of the utility model are: this utility model can to steel plate by the laser range finder of movement, ferrum plate, steel pipe, the overall dimensions of the scrap metals such as aluminum pipe carries out automatic Scanning Detction, and send detection data to host computer and carry out statistic record and automatic encoding, and then set up the data base of waste material, when needing to choose waste material, only need to input long on host computer, wide, higher size search condition can find out whether waste material in need, transfer workman and use the enthusiasm of waste material, production cost is greatly reduced under the premise ensureing production efficiency, avoid the environmental pollution caused because waste material abandons simultaneously.

Detailed description of the invention:
With reference to each accompanying drawing, this metal takes material size automatic measuring recording equipment, including workbench 1 and switch board 10, near being symmetrically arranged on two with support column 2 on described workbench 1, it is provided with slideway 12 near upper end level between two support columns 2, slideway 12 is provided with slide block 3, the top of one of them support column 2 is provided with the first electric cylinder 4, first leading screw 17 connection sliding block 3 of the first electric cylinder 4, described slide block 3 is provided with the second electric cylinder 5, the end of the second leading screw 9 of the second electric cylinder 5 is provided with locating piece 6, the bottom of locating piece 6 is provided with laser range finder 7, laser range finder 7 connects the controller 16 in switch board 10, controller 16 connects host computer 15 by network.
During use, workpiece for measurement is placed on workbench 5, starts the first electric cylinder 4, make the first leading screw 17 band movable slider 3 move along slideway 12;Start the second electric cylinder 5, the second leading screw 9 is made to drive locating piece 6 to move, and then make laser range finder 7 all around move, by the movement of laser range finder 11, workpiece is scanned, thus measuring the length and width of workpiece, measured data are sent to the controller 16 in switch board 10 by laser range finder 7, controller 16 transfers data to host computer 15 by network, detection data are automatically converted into mechanical dimension the number record of waste material workpiece by host computer 15, staff can pass through host computer 12 and find recycling waste material, specifically can pass through length, width, the search conditions such as height find out required waste material.
This detailed description of the invention arranges the position sensor 8 being connected with controller 16 further on fixed block 6, controller 16 connects the first electric cylinder 4 and the second electric cylinder 5 respectively, the particular location of laser range finder 7 is detected in real time by position sensor 8, controller 16 controls the operation of the first electric cylinder 4 and the second electric cylinder 5 and then the shift position of auto-control laser range finder 7 according to its physical location.Described laser range finder 7 and position sensor 8 sequentially pass through signal conditioner 13 respectively and A/D converter 14 connects controller 16.
